About this service

A range hood is essential for venting smoke, grease, and carbon monoxide produced by your gas stove. You need one if your kitchen air feels heavy or if cooking odors linger too long. It keeps your indoor air quality safe and prevents heat buildup near the ceiling. Professional installation ensures the exhaust system is properly ducted to the outside of your home, which is necessary for effective performance and meeting local safety building codes.

How often should I schedule maintenance for my gas fireplace insert in Chicago?

Scheduling annual maintenance for your gas fireplace insert in Chicago is highly recommended to ensure its safe and efficient operation. During a service appointment, a qualified technician will thoroughly inspect and clean the unit's components, including the burner assembly, pilot assembly, and venting system. They will also check for any gas leaks and test the thermopile and thermocouple for proper function. This proactive approach helps prevent potential issues, extends the lifespan of your insert, and ensures it provides reliable warmth throughout Chicago's cold winters.

Can a gas fireplace insert be used during a power outage in Chicago?

Many gas fireplace inserts in Chicago can operate during a power outage, provided they have a standing pilot light or a battery backup system. These systems allow the burner to ignite and produce heat even without electricity. However, features like remote controls, blowers, or electronic ignition might not function. It's essential to check your specific insert's model and capabilities to confirm its performance during a power disruption common in Chicago's unpredictable weather.

How do I know if my gas fireplace insert needs repair in Chicago?

If your gas fireplace insert in Chicago is exhibiting unusual symptoms, it likely needs repair. Common signs include a pilot light that won't stay lit, inconsistent flame patterns, unusual noises during operation, or a failure to ignite altogether. You might also notice a persistent smell of gas, which is a critical indicator requiring immediate attention. If the unit isn't producing adequate heat or the remote control is unresponsive, it's also time to call a professional for diagnosis and repair.

What are the advantages of a gas fireplace insert over a traditional wood-burning fireplace in Chicago?

Gas fireplace inserts offer several advantages over traditional wood-burning fireplaces in Chicago. They provide instant heat with the flip of a switch or remote control, eliminating the need to source, store, and tend to firewood. Gas units are generally cleaner burning, producing fewer emissions and less soot, which is beneficial for indoor air quality and chimney maintenance. Furthermore, they offer consistent and reliable heat output, making them an efficient supplemental heating source for Chicago homes during colder months.
